Best Kerala food experiences in Kochi

Trying appam stew and authentic Kerala breakfast dishes

Kochi is one of Kerala’s best destinations for trying authentic breakfast dishes such as appam with stew, puttu, kadala curry, idiyappam, and coconut-based local cuisine that reflect Kerala’s traditional food culture.

Small heritage cafés and local restaurants often provide the most authentic experiences.

Traditional Kerala sadya served on banana leaves

Traditional Kerala sadya meals served on banana leaves offer one of the most complete cultural dining experiences through multiple vegetarian dishes, rice, curries, pickles, payasam, and regional cooking traditions.

Sadya meals become especially popular during festivals and cultural celebrations in Kerala.

Best street food and local snack experiences

Trying Kerala banana chips pazhampori and local tea shop snacks

Kochi’s local snack culture includes Kerala banana chips, pazhampori, parippu vada, tea shop snacks, and freshly fried local treats that reflect the city’s everyday food traditions.

Small tea shops and roadside cafés often provide the most authentic snack experiences.

Local toddy shop food and authentic village style meals

Kochi’s toddy shops offer some of the most authentic Kerala food experiences through spicy seafood dishes, tapioca meals, fish curry, local cooking traditions, and relaxed countryside-style dining atmosphere.

These places often feel more local and culturally immersive than tourist-focused restaurants.
